Great park by the ocean. Mountain bike trails are plentiful,well maintained and clearly marked. Beach access and camping, hiking, fishing and canoe rentals available also. Great outdoor activities for the whole family.

Overall nice beach, still the best beach in Jax for families and having the bathrooms and showers to clean up when you leave the beach makes for easier clean up when you get home.
